One of our users is using Tomcat 4.1.29/java-1.4.2 on w2k3 server, and
he has strange problems with our webservice.
Tomcat suddenly throws at every request a ClientAbortException, like
the following:

ERROR 2006-10-30 07:21:17,736 - ClientAbortException:
java.net.SocketException: Connection reset by peer: socket write error
        at 
org.apache.coyote.tomcat4.OutputBuffer.realWriteBytes(OutputBuffer.java:404)
        at org.apache.tomcat.util.buf.ByteChunk.append(ByteChunk.java:353)
        at 
org.apache.coyote.tomcat4.OutputBuffer.writeBytes(OutputBuffer.java:432)
        at org.apache.coyote.tomcat4.OutputBuffer.write(OutputBuffer.java:419)
        at 
org.apache.coyote.tomcat4.CoyoteOutputStream.write(CoyoteOutputStream.java:108)
        at 
com.agosys.unicom.servlet.UnicomServlet.handleRequest(UnicomServlet.java:84)

The problem can only be resolved by restarting the service.

If this is a known problem - I don't care and advice my user to
upgrade, however its kind of hard if I am not sure (those are
production servers at a very large company).
Is this a known problem, is there something I could do to prevent
these failures or whats causing them?
